Utah Symphony Schedule – Fall 2008

Single tickets went on sale for Utah Symphony | Utah Opera’s 2008-2009 season today. Here are a list of Utah Symphony’s upcoming performances:

September 2008
Ode to Joy (September 12, 13) Classical A
A Waterbird Talk (September 24, 25) Ardean Watts Contemporary Chamber Series
Judy Garland in concert with the Utah Symphony (September 26, 27) Pops
Salute to Youth (September 30) Discovery

October 2008
Land of the Midnight Music (October 10, 11) Classical B, Finishing Touches
Marvin Hamlish with the Utah Symphony (October 17, 18) Pops
Halloween High-Jinks (October 25) Lollipops
Bruckner’s 4th – A Big Brass Show (October 31, November 1) Classical C

November 2008
Elgar’s Cello Concerto (November 7, 8 ) Classical A
An Evening of Film Music (November 14, 15) Pops
Shostakovich’s Response (November 21, 22) Classical C, Finishing Touches
Sing-it-Yourself Messiah (November 29, 30)

Since I’m a brass player (trumpet & French horn), I’m really excited for Bruckner’s 4th and Shostakovich’s 5th symphonies. In fact, I’ve been looking forward to these since I first heard we were performing them earlier this year. Both of them have awesome brass parts – and they’re loud and exciting, two qualities I love in music. Ode to Joy and Elgar’s Cello Concerto (if you’ve seen August Rush, you’ll recognize this song, kind of) are also going to be really fun.
